Former Lawmaker, Muktari Bajeh Extends Condolences to Kogi Governor Over Father’s Passing
A former member of the Kogi State House of Assembly, Hon. Muktari Bajeh, has condoled with Governor Ahmed Usman Ododo over the demise of his beloved father, Alhaji Ahmed Momohsani Ododo, at 83.
In a heartfelt message, Hon. Bajeh described the passing of a father as one of the most difficult moments in any person’s life, leaving behind a void impossible to fill.
Hon. Bajeh praised the late Alhaji Ododo as a man of honour, humility, and quiet strength, whose life of discipline, moral uprightness, and service to family and community laid a solid foundation for the leader Governor Ododo has become today.
He noted that the governor’s father’s values and legacy are evident in Governor Ododo’s character, vision, and dedication to serving the people of Kogi State.
The former majority leader prayed for Almighty Allah to grant Governor Ododo the strength to bear the loss with patience and fortitude.
He also prayed for the forgiveness of the late Alhaji Ododo’s shortcomings and for him to be granted Aljannatul Firdaus.
